WATER BAPTISM 

As Christians we believe in baptism in the name of the Father, Son and the Holy Ghost - Matthew 28: 19. 

The teaching is revealed in the New Testament and all Christians must obey this rule of the Lord - Acts 2: 4; 16: 15; 30-33; Acts 18:8; 19:4-5.

Every saved soul automatically qualifies for water baptism - Acts 8:29-39; 16:28

We believe that all Christians should receive water baptism by immersion in the name of the Father, Son and the Holy Ghost as believers who will not add or take out of the word of God – Matthew 28:19; 3:16.  

Water baptism stands for a sign and example of two things: 

1. It is an outstanding sign and an example of true repentance of a sinner from his/her sins - Acts 2:38; 22:16.  

2. Anybody who is baptised is joined with Christ in His death, burial and resurrection - Romans 6:1 -end; Col. 2:13. Therefore, anybody who is baptised is dead to the world and the evils thereof -  Galatians 6: 14.
